Weather and Best Time to Visit

the Dominican Republic's weather is key to enjoying your visit. The dry season, from December to April, offers sunny days with minimal rainfall, making it ideal for beach-goers and outdoor adventurers. However, this is also when the Dominican Republic sees the most tourists, so expect larger crowds and higher prices. The wet season brings short bursts of rain, usually in the afternoon, which can be a refreshing break from the heat. This period also sees fewer tourists, offering a more laid-back experience with the potential for lower prices.

Dominican Time and Culture

Dominican culture is a vibrant mix of influences that reflects the country's complex history and diverse population. Music and dance, particularly merengue and bachata, are integral to Dominican life, offering a window into the island's soul. The annual Carnival, celebrated each February, is a must-see explosion of color, music, and dance that showcases the country's artistic diversity.

Dominican cuisine, a delicious fusion of Spanish, Taino, and African flavors, is a highlight for many visitors. Dishes like the savory "la bandera" (the flag), consisting of rice, beans, meat, and salad, offer a taste of the island's rich culinary landscape. Street food, with options like empanadas and tostones (fried plantains), provides a flavorful insight into the daily Dominican diet.

Exploring Beyond the Beaches

Santo Domingo: The Heart of Dominican History Santo Domingo, the capital city, is a UNESCO World Heritage site brimming with historical landmarks such as the first cathedral of the Americas, Catedral Primada de América, and the Alcázar de Colón, once the residence of Christopher Columbus's son. The city's Colonial Zone offers a journey back in time with its well-preserved architecture and cobblestone streets.

Puerto Plata: Where Adventure Meets History Puerto Plata, on the northern coast, is not only known for its beautiful beaches but also for its rich cultural heritage and adventure opportunities. The 27 Waterfalls of Damajagua offer an exhilarating experience for nature enthusiasts, while the historic San Felipe Fortress tells tales of the past.

Dominican Republic's Best Beaches and Natural Wonders Punta Cana is synonymous with beaches that are a slice of heaven, but the Dominican Republic's coastline is diverse. From the serene waters of Playa Rincón in Samaná to the windsurfing paradise of Cabarete, there's a beach for every type of traveler. The country's interior is equally impressive, with the majestic Pico Duarte and the serene Lake Enriquillo offering unforgettable natural experiences.

Beyond the Shoreline: Adventures and Discoveries


While the Dominican Republic's beaches are legendary, the interior of the country offers its own set of wonders. The Central Mountain Range, including Pico Duarte, the Caribbean's highest peak, offers challenging hikes and breathtaking views. The Los Haitises National Park, with its unique karst landscapes and rich biodiversity, is a haven for eco-tourists and bird watchers.

Cave systems, such as the Cueva de las Maravillas, showcase ancient Taino petroglyphs, offering a glimpse into the island's pre-Columbian past. The Dominican Republic's rivers and waterfalls, including the mesmerizing Salto del Limón, provide opportunities for swimming, rafting, and canyoning, offering a refreshing counterpoint to the beach-focused tourism of the coast.
